Welcome to guest author Elodie Parkes
Elodie writes contemporary romance and erotic romance.
Elodie Parkes currently lives in Canterbury, United Kingdom,
(of Chaucer fame), with her two dogs. Elodie loves to go to the coast whenever
she can.
She combines writing with her job in a local antiques shop
and says the people she meets there often spark a story idea.
Presently she is working on another erotic, contemporary
romance Two of Them, expected release
date August 5, 2012
Her new book Millie
Re-invented is about a young woman who suddenly realizes that her husband
has not really been kissing her for a couple of years. Millie is kissed by a
young man who works in the same firm as she does at their Christmas party, and
the kiss is so different and enjoyable it jolts her into the realization that
she has been kissing her husband but he’s just been taking it. It’s not the
only thing he’s been taking.
Millie finds herself assessing her relationship with her
husband over the next months as the young man who kissed her at the party
starts to pursue her.
The things Millie finds out about her husband astonish her.
She falls into a relationship with the young man August. He
is very special and begins to love Millie entirely.
As Millie and August’s relationship deepens the reader will
delight in their love scenes.
There are some fun aspects to this erotic romance when
Millie meets August’s friendship group from university. The reader will
instantly like the group of women in this book and fall in love with August
themselves. His journey is told with tenderness by the author.
